ARM? Cortex?-M0 STM32F0 Microcontroller IC 32-Bit 48MHz 32KB (32K x 8) FLASH 20-TSSOP
Parameter Description Value/Range
Package Package type TSSOP20
Operating Voltage Supply voltage range 1.8V to 3.6V
Core Processor core ARM? Cortex?-M0
Clock Speed Maximum CPU clock frequency 48 MHz
Flash Memory On-chip Flash memory size 32 KB
RAM On-chip SRAM size 4 KB
Temperature Range Operating temperature range -40°C to +85°C
I/O Pins Number of I/O pins 14
ADC Analog-to-Digital Converter resolution 12-bit, up to 1 MSPS
DAC Digital-to-Analog Converter channels 1 channel, 12-bit
Timers General-purpose timers 2x 16-bit
Communication Interfaces Supported communication interfaces UART, SPI, I2C
Low Power Modes Available low power modes Sleep, Stop, Standby
DMA Channels Direct Memory Access channels 7 channels
Watchdog Timers Watchdog timer types Independent watchdog, Window watchdog
Reset and Supply Management Reset and supply management features POR, PDR, Backup domain, Brownout detection

Instructions for Use:

  1. Power Supply:

    • Ensure the supply voltage is within the specified range (1.8V to 3.6V).
    • Connect the VDD pin to the power supply and VSS to ground.
  2. Clock Configuration:

    • Configure the system clock using internal or external oscillators.
    • The maximum clock speed is 48 MHz.
  3. Memory Initialization:

    • Initialize the Flash memory and RAM according to the application requirements.
    • Use the provided HAL libraries or directly configure via register settings.
  4. Peripheral Setup:

    • Configure ADC, DAC, timers, and communication interfaces as needed.
    • Set up DMA channels for efficient data transfer.
  5. Power Management:

    • Utilize sleep, stop, and standby modes to manage power consumption effectively.
    • Implement brownout detection and reset functionalities for robust operation.
  6. Programming and Debugging:

    • Use an appropriate IDE such as STM32CubeIDE for development.
    • Program the device using SWD interface for debugging and firmware updates.
  7. Handling and Storage:

    • Handle with care to avoid ESD damage.
    • Store in a dry environment within the recommended temperature range.
